Cleaning and Maintaining Your Teeth and Aligners

To prevent bacterial buildup and staining, it’s essential to clean your teeth regularly. In the morning and before bed, gently brush your teeth with fluoride toothpaste and rinse with a fluoride mouthwash. For your Invisalign aligners, you can soak them in warm water mixed with a gentle dishwasher detergent or an Invisalign-approved cleaning solution. Remove stubborn stains or debris by gently scrubbing the aligners with a soft-bristled toothbrush. Rinse your aligners thoroughly with warm water and dry them with a clean towel after cleaning.

The Importance of Wearing Aligners for 20-22 Hours a Day

To achieve optimal results and ensure a smooth treatment process, it’s crucial to wear your Invisalign aligners for at least 20-22 hours a day. This duration allows your teeth to move and adjust to the new positions, promoting even and healthy tooth movement. Wearing aligners for shorter periods may slow down the treatment process or lead to inadequate results. Be sure to keep track of your wear time to ensure you’re following your orthodontist’s instructions correctly.

Managing Tooth Sensitivity and Discomfort

Some people may experience mild tooth sensitivity or discomfort during Invisalign treatment. This is usually due to the tooth moving into its new position, but it can also be a sign of sensitivity to the aligners or the adhesive. If you experience persistent or severe discomfort, consult your orthodontist for advice. They can help adjust your treatment plan, provide desensitizing toothpaste, or offer other solutions to alleviate the discomfort.

Q: What is the average cost of Invisalign treatment?

The average cost of Invisalign treatment varies depending on the complexity of your case and the number of aligners needed. On average, the cost can range from $3,000 to $8,000.

Q: Can I pay for Invisalign treatment in instalments?

Yes, many Invisalign providers offer financing options and payment plans to make the treatment more affordable. It’s essential to discuss your payment options with your dentist during your initial consultation.

Q: How long does Invisalign treatment typically last?

The duration of Invisalign treatment varies depending on the complexity of your case. On average, treatment can take anywhere from 6 to 18 months.

Q: Are Invisalign aligners suitable for children and teenagers?

Invisalign aligners are suitable for children and teenagers, but a dentist or orthodontist must assess their teeth and jaws to determine if Invisalign is the right choice for their specific needs.
